Freshmen Rebound After Slow Start After losing their first five games, the Freshmen players began to play the kind of basketball that they are capable of. The Freshmen Tigers recorded their first win of the season against the New Athens Yellow Jackets. From this point on, the young team played .500 basketball. The Freshmen could have had an even better season if some of the players had not been needed on the Junior Varsity squad. Another factor that kept the Freshmen from winning more games than they did, was that the team suffered from numerous injuries and cases of the flu Number 23. Mike Ryan, appears to be sleepwalking during this game. by many key players. The Freshmen Tigers’ season was ended by arch rival Columbia in the second round of the Cahokia Conference Freshman Tournament. The team was coached by Richard Bright. Krista Sloan Is First Female Athlete To Win Scholarship . Back Row: Coach Sheets, Ramona Sloan, Kim Edwards. Tammy Cooper, Krista Sloan, Karen Price, Coach Kern; Front Row: LaDonna Buatte. Gina Tolbird. Sheena Bryant. Linda McDonald. Kendra Pratt, Laurie Stufflebean The 1983-84 girls varsity basketball team had another successful year with 13 wins-8 losses. The Varsity scored the highest number of points (74) against an opponent. The team placed second in the Sparta Tournament and reached the semi-finals of the Regional Tournament. Kim Edwards was named to the All-Star Team following her fine performance in the Sparta Tournament. Krista Sloan received the first 4-year scholarship ever to be won by a D.C.H.S. female athlete. She was also voted to two area newspapers’ all-star teams. The team overall played with enthusiasm and intensity and each squad member contributed a great deal to the success of this year.
